Pros

The events they plan are a lot of fun and they create a great community. They get tons of projects which means there is always something new.

Cons

Younger engineers are paid very little and it takes a long time to work up to a decent pay. Long hours are expected and while schedule is flexible, everyone seems to end up getting burnt out from the unrelenting schedule of project deadlines

Coffman Engineers Response
3y
We do have a strong reputation in the Pacific which continues to bring in lots of interesting projects. Unfortunately, it is difficult to find people in the Honolulu market, which can exacerbate the work/life balance issue. I will continue to work on work-sharing options with other offices to lighten the load in Honolulu. Thanks for the feedback. Dave Ruff - CEO
